Location
NASA Ames Research Center
Moffett Field, CA 94035-1000
The main lecture series will take place in The AbSciCon 2002 Conference
Tent, located in Moffett Field's historic Hangar One. Breakout sessions
will be held in The Moffett Training and Conference Center (Building
3), located just across the street from Hangar One. Posters sessions
will be held within the Hangar venue surrounding The Conference Tent.

Poster Information
Area for each poster is 48"H x 46"W. One 4' x 8' piece of
foam core set upon two easels is provided. Two posters will be displayed
per each piece of foam core. We will provide pushpins to mount posters
to the foamcore. Please carry your poster with you to the Conference
as there are no shipping or receiving services available for this event.
Plan to put up your poster during the Sunday evening reception or on
Monday. If the number of posters exceeds available poster space, there
will be a second shift for poster display. Poster exhibitors will receive
e-mail notification.
